Raipalpur

Raipalpur is a village located in Akbarpur tehsil of Kanpur Dehat district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 25km away from sub-district headquarter Akbarpur (tehsildar office) and 25km away from district headquarter Ramabayi Nagar , Mati. As per 2009 stats, Raipalpur village is also a gram panchayat.

About Raipalpur

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Raipalpur is 149267. The village spans a total geographical area of 725.285 hectares. Akbarpur is nearest town to Raipalpur village for all major economic activities.

Population of Raipalpur

According to the 2011 Census, Raipalpur has a total population of about 3,822, with approximately 2,027 males and 1,795 females. The sex ratio is around 885 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 505 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 816 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population includes 1 person. The overall literacy rate is approximately 70.41%, with male literacy at about 75.14% and female literacy near 65.07%. There are around 690 households in the village. Connectivity of Raipalpur

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Raipalpur. As per the 2011 stats, Raipalpur had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Railway Station Available within 5 - 10 km distance
